Understanding user behavior is fundamental to improving PPC performance. Data gathered through behavioral analytics sheds light on what drives visitor actions and conversions. By analyzing clicking patterns, time spent on-page, and engagement levels, marketers can identify content that resonates well with users. For instance, if data indicates that users flock to specific products or services, businesses can shift ad focus towards these high-interest items. Additionally, behavioral trends reveal common obstacles preventing conversion, enabling targeted adjustments. These modifications can include tweaking landing pages to enhance user experience, optimizing loading speeds, or refining call-to-action (CTA) prompts. A well-structured PPC campaign should not only focus on keywords and ad placements but also consider how users engage with the site post-click. This holistic approach recommends using A/B testing to measure the effectiveness of different strategies. Marketing teams can experiment with various landing page designs and messaging to evaluate user responses. Continuous analysis of this data creates opportunities for better targeting and messaging, fostering an environment where conversions can flourish through relevant interactions. Thus, user behavior directly impacts the effectiveness and efficiency of PPC initiatives.

The Importance of A/B Testing

A/B testing stands as a pivotal component of effective PPC and CRO integration. By comparing two versions of an ad, marketers can assess which performs better in driving conversions. This systematic approach allows for informed decisions, minimizing guesswork and enhancing the potential for success. Testing can target multiple variables, such as headlines, images, or ad copy, providing valuable insights into user preferences. Consistent testing of these elements ensures that PPC campaigns evolve and adapt to audience needs. In practice, it becomes essential to test how different landing pages impact conversion rates. A simple change in layout or wording can significantly influence user behavior toward completing a desired action. Furthermore, insights from testing can inform future ad campaigns, creating a feedback loop that sharpens online marketing strategies. In today’s fast-paced digital landscape, remaining static in marketing efforts is risky. Thus, regularly employing A/B testing aligns campaign objectives with user behaviors, ultimately improving overall performance. Key to the long-term success of PPC campaigns, this optimization fosters growth and profitability.

The Role of Personalization

Incorporating personalization into PPC strategies can yield remarkable results in conversion rates. Behavioral analytics enables marketers to identify segments within their audience. By understanding user demographics, interests, and behaviors, businesses can tailor their messaging and offers effectively. Personalized ads resonate more profoundly with users, enhancing engagement and driving higher conversion rates. For instance, businesses can leverage data to create dynamic ad campaigns that showcase products aligned with specific user interests. This targeted approach not only grabs attention but also encourages clicks and purchases. Moreover, personalization extends beyond the ad itself; landing pages should also reflect these customized experiences. Crafting landing pages that speak to individual users solidifies trust and improves conversion chances significantly. Furthermore, targeted recommendations based on past user interactions can enhance the overall purchasing experience. This level of personalization not only drives immediate results but also promotes longer-term customer relationships. Marketers must strive to continuously refine personalization tactics through ongoing analysis of user feedback and behavioral trends. Ultimately, an effective personalized PPC strategy can transform visitor experiences, leading to higher satisfaction and increased sales.

Another vital aspect of successful PPC is understanding customer journey stages. Recognizing where users are within their buying journey can inform PPC targeting strategies. For instance, users at the awareness stage may respond better to educational content rather than direct sales pitches. Conversely, users further along in the journey might appreciate promotional offers or CTAs. Behavioral analytics serves as a guiding light in this regard, providing clarity on user actions leading up to conversion. By analyzing engagement milestones, marketers can create tailored campaigns for each user stage. Additionally, this understanding enables businesses to effectively allocate resources towards the most opportune moments for targeted marketing interventions. Ad placements, timing, and messaging can all be optimized by correlating PPC efforts with user journey insights. This cohesive alignment significantly boosts conversion rates, as users are met with relevant content when they are most receptive. Moreover, developing tailored follow-up strategies enhances customer retention. Thus, tunneling down to intricacies within customer journeys allows for more informed marketing tactics, making it imperative for businesses striving for high conversion rates.
